Release date: January 31, 2018 (Pre-order January 18 at 10 PM Korea time)
Purchase links: Full Slip - Lenticular Slip - 1/4 Slip - One-Click
Price: TBA
Notes: Full Slip: 1200 copies - Lenticular Slip: 1200 copies - 1/4 Slip: 700 copies - One-Click: 300 copies
